B. ILLUS: WARBLER BIRDS DETECT STORMS

1. In East Tennessee there's a bird known as the Golden Winged Warbler. These birds recently did something unusual a few days before a supercell storm hit—they started fleeing their nests.

2. Researchers were testing whether the warblers, which weigh "less than two nickels," could carry geolocators on their backs. They can. With a big storm brewing, the birds took off from their breeding ground and travelled 900 miles in five days to avoid the tornado-producing storms.

3. The Warblers apparently knew in advance that the storm was coming. Scientists believe that there's some kind of infrasound frequency that alerts them that the storms are coming.

4. LESSON? If we know that the storms of judgment are coming, we should find a refuge. [Science Daily, Cell Press journal, Current Biology 12-18].

A. TOXIC ASSETS.

1. The 2009 economic crisis was brought about by toxic assets. Toxic assets are loans that banks made that turned negative (lost their value).

2. Toxic assets can also be spiritual. A toxic asset is anything we think is good but is actually hurting us spiritually. Pornography, drugs or alcohol, illicit relationships are all deadly. But so are many things we see as benefiting us.

3. A house or a car can be a toxic when it takes over your life and pushes God out. A job can be spiritually toxic. Money, education, family and friends, beauty or handsomeness—CAN BE great assets unless you allow them to take God's place in your life.

B. HARMLESS LITTLE SIN

1. Ken Henderson, a traveling salesman, came to Kennett, Missouri, in January 2011, selling exotic animals. He had 50 baby alligators, each the size of a pencil. Everyone in the small Missouri town was soon enamored of the cute reptiles. He sold a lot of them, and then moved on.

2. But a year later, the little creatures weren’t so cute; they had grown to about 3 feet in long. They were eating several pounds of meat every day. One lady who had bought two of them, was known to take them out for walks on leashes.

3. She thought they were harmless, until they started jumping toward her and snapping at her hands and arms. An expert said, "As they grow in size, their disposition changes. Like a lion cub as he gets big, it's wild instincts grow. They really aren’t suitable as pets." [Houston Chronicle, A4, "Gators as pets prove to be a pain." April 7, 2012].

4. It’s the SAME WITH SIN. It looks harmless at first; you can’t see how it could hurt you. But in time its true nature begins to take control, and what you thought you could control, soon grows into a life-threatening danger, not only to you, but everyone around you!
